CVE-2026-45637: Windows DWM Privilege Escalation Flaw

CVE-2026-45637 is a use-after-free privilege escalation vulnerability in Windows DWM Core Library that allows authenticated attackers to elevate privileges. This article covers technical details, affected versions, and mitigation.

Published:

CVE-2026-45637 Overview

CVE-2026-45637 is a use-after-free vulnerability [CWE-416] in the Windows Desktop Window Manager (DWM) Core Library. An authorized local attacker can leverage the flaw to elevate privileges on an affected Windows system. Microsoft published the advisory through the Microsoft Security Response Center (MSRC).

The vulnerability carries a CVSS 3.1 base score of 7.8 and requires local access with low privileges. Successful exploitation results in high impact to confidentiality, integrity, and availability. No public proof-of-concept code or active exploitation has been reported as of publication.

Technical Details for CVE-2026-45637

Vulnerability Analysis

The vulnerability resides in the Windows Desktop Window Manager (DWM) Core Library, the component responsible for compositing and rendering desktop graphics. The flaw is classified as a use-after-free condition [CWE-416], where memory is referenced after it has been released.

When DWM processes graphics objects, an object reference can persist after the underlying memory has been freed. An attacker who controls subsequent allocations can place attacker-influenced data into the freed region. The dangling pointer then dereferences attacker-controlled content during later DWM operations.

Because DWM runs with elevated privileges in the Windows session, controlled corruption of its internal state can lead to privilege escalation from a standard user context to higher integrity levels.

Root Cause

The root cause is improper object lifetime management within the DWM Core Library. The component releases a graphics object while another code path still holds a reference to it. The subsequent use of the freed reference enables memory corruption.

Attack Vector

Exploitation requires local access and low privileges. The attacker runs code on the target host as an authenticated user. No user interaction is required beyond the attacker's own session activity. The attacker triggers a sequence of DWM operations that frees an object, sprays the heap to control the freed region, then invokes the code path that dereferences the stale pointer. Successful exploitation yields code execution at DWM's privilege level.

No verified public exploitation code is available. Technical details are limited to Microsoft's advisory.

Detection Methods for CVE-2026-45637

Indicators of Compromise

  • Unexpected crashes of dwm.exe or modules loaded by the Desktop Window Manager process
  • Application Error events (Event ID 1000) referencing dwmcore.dll access violations
  • New processes spawned from dwm.exe or token manipulation associated with the DWM process

Detection Strategies

  • Monitor for abnormal child processes or thread injection targeting dwm.exe
  • Correlate DWM process crashes with subsequent privileged process creation by the same user session
  • Track loading of unsigned or unusual modules into the DWM process address space

Monitoring Recommendations

  • Enable Windows Error Reporting telemetry collection for DWM crashes across endpoints
  • Forward Sysmon Event ID 10 (ProcessAccess) and Event ID 8 (CreateRemoteThread) targeting dwm.exe to a central SIEM
  • Baseline normal DWM behavior per host so anomalous memory access patterns surface quickly

How to Mitigate CVE-2026-45637

Immediate Actions Required

  • Apply the Microsoft security update referenced in the Microsoft CVE-2026-45637 Advisory as soon as it is available for the affected build
  • Inventory Windows hosts to identify systems running vulnerable DWM Core Library versions
  • Prioritize patching on multi-user systems such as Remote Desktop Session Hosts and shared workstations

Patch Information

Microsoft addresses CVE-2026-45637 through its standard security update channel. Refer to the Microsoft CVE-2026-45637 Advisory for the specific KB articles, supported builds, and update package identifiers. Deploy the update through Windows Update, Windows Server Update Services (WSUS), or your configuration management platform.

Workarounds

  • No official workaround has been published; apply the vendor patch as the primary remediation
  • Restrict interactive logon rights on sensitive systems to reduce the population of users who can launch local exploitation
  • Enforce application control policies (such as Windows Defender Application Control) to limit execution of untrusted binaries that could trigger the vulnerable code path
